Output 542509ebe5c9356b00a61ac01c9ae3034d1fa65efb7d0c92342895c1be028f76:1

value
263469265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f84bce02e87097a6a34d54c5f7632d6060be17d7 OP_EQUAL
address
3QKtK85NR7VoMd6ToLXA992T7FkuPJCYdc
transaction
542509ebe5c9356b00a61ac01c9ae3034d1fa65efb7d0c92342895c1be028f76
spent
true